The Mom Test (Field Guide for Founders)
I’ve read a lot of startup books, but few have changed how I actually work the way The Mom Test has.
It’s direct, plainspoken, and mercilessly useful—like the best kind of mentor who saves you from yourself.
The heart of it is simple: if you’re building anything and talking to customers, you’re probably getting lied to.
Not maliciously—people just want to be nice.
This book teaches you how to cut through the compliments, dodge the fake enthusiasm, and get to the real stuff that helps you build something people actually need.
